All Day Breakfasts Convenience-style

There are plenty of ways of making a quick cooked all day vegan breakfast! There is a recipe below but if that's even too much...try the microwavable Amy's Breakfast Sandwich! (with some salad and fruit on the side of course ;o)
TOP TIP
If using a microwave to cook sausages, don't overcook as they can become very tough.
Ingredients:
1 portion per person of the following
- Vegan sausages - eg Linda McCartney or other brands. Alternatively, use Taifun wieners (like hot dogs)
- Mushrooms - a few sliced, smeared with a little oil, garlic puree and soya sauce
- Fresh tomatoes, cut in half or chopped
- Vegan rashers (vegan bacon or tempeh), eg Tofurkey, Impulse Food or VBites
- Baked Beans
- Toast or potato scones plus vegan butter (eg Pure, M&S Sunflower, Tesco Free From, Biona, Suma)
OPTIONAL EXTRAS
- Super-fast Scrambled Tofu - make this while everything else is cooking
- Avocado, sliced
- Spinach (wilted or raw)
- Pumpkin or sunflower seeds
- Alfalfa sprouts
Method:
- Microwave or fry the sausages, mushrooms and tomatoes.
- Fry the rashers if using.
- Microwave or heat the baked beans on the stove.
- Make the scrambled tofu if using.
- Toast the bread or potato scones.
- Slice the avocado if using.
- Assemble all the food on a plate(s) and eat while hot!
